Sound Advice On Hearing Protection
You need sound so you can experience your environment and communicate with others.
But too much sound can damage your hearing and leave you isolated. Excess noise can also cause fatigue, stress and irritability which can lead to workplace injuries.
Sound can damage your hearing in two ways. You can lose your hearing ability all at once from a loud noise such as an explosion or gunshot. The more common cause of work-related hearing loss is continual exposure to excess noise, causing gradual loss of hearing.
The preferred line of defense is noise reduction and other engineering solutions which lessen your exposure to noise.
Hearing loss may not sound like too serious a disability, but in fact it makes for a lonely life. Don’t take your hearing for granted — protect it for all its worth.
